On Samsung devices, unlocking the bootloader "trips" Knox security, which can permanently disable features like Samsung Pay, Samsung Pass, and Secure Folder. Identifying Scams So, what is this tool if it's not legitimate

Q: Will unlocking my bootloader erase my data? A: Yes, unlocking a bootloader will typically erase all data on the device, so users should back up their data before proceeding.

The Bitly link doesn't lead to a tool at all. It leads to a website claiming "Your system has 5 viruses" or "OEM License failed – Call this number." That number is a tech support scam who will charge you $300 to "fix" a problem that doesn't exist.
